#18FEFB Hex Color Code

#18FEFB

The Hexadecimal Color #18FEFB is a contrast shade of Aqua. #18FEFB RGB value is rgb(24, 254, 251). RGB Color Model of #18FEFB consists of 9% red, 99% green and 98% blue. HSL color Mode of #18FEFB has 179°(degrees) Hue, 99% Saturation and 55% Lightness. #18FEFB color has an wavelength of 507.2963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#18FEFB is #33FF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#18FEFB is #1FF. The Closest Color to #18FEFB is #00FFFF. Official Name of #18FEFB Hex Code is Cyan / Aqua.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#18FEFB is 91 Cyan 0 Magenta 1 Yellow 0 Black and #18FEFB CMY is 91, 0, 1.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#18FEFB is hsl(179,99,55,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(179, 91, 100).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#18FEFB is 53.22, 78.04, 103.51.
Hex8 Value of #18FEFB is #18FEFBFF. Decimal Value of #18FEFB is 1638139 and Octal Value of #18FEFB is 6177373. Binary Value of #18FEFB is 11000, 11111110, 11111011 and Android of #18FEFB is 4279828219 / 0xff18fefb.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#18FEFB is 0.227, 0.332, 0.332 and YIQ Color Space of #18FEFB is 184.888, -136.0931, -49.5786.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#18FEFB is 55.72, 95.66, 103.01.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#18FEFB is 90.8, -48.22, -12.52.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#18FEFB is 90.8, -69.76, -12.5.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#18FEFB is 90.8, 49.82, 194.56. Hunter Lab variable of #18FEFB is 88.34, -47.06, -7.63.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#18FEFB

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
